免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

au直播app开发

AU直播App是一款基于互联网的实时视频直播应用,它通过将用户的实时视频内容传输到服务器上,并通过网络实时分发给其他用户观看,实现了用户与用户之间的实时交流和互动。本文将从AU直播App的原理和详细介绍两个方面来阐述。

一、原理介绍

1. 视频编码与传输:AU直播App通过将用户手机摄像头采集的视频内容进行编码压缩,通常采用H.264标准进行压缩。编码后的视频数据会经过网络传输到服务器,再通过服务器将视频分发给其他用户。

2. 服务器处理:服务器在接收到用户上传的视频数据后,会进行解码和处理,然后将视频数据进行存储和分发。为了保证实时性,服务器需要具备强大的处理能力和带宽支持。

3. 视频分发:服务器会将用户上传的视频数据实时地发送给其他用户观看。服务器通常采用多播或点对点的方式进行视频分发,以保证视频数据能够高效地传输到用户的设备上。

4. 视频解码与播放:其他用户收到服务器分发的视频数据后,会对视频进行解码和播放。解码过程与编码过程相反,将压缩的视频数据还原为原始的视频内容,然后通过播放器进行播放。

二、详细介绍

1. 用户注册与登录:用户首先需要在AU直播App上进行注册,并创建自己的账号。注册完成后,用户可以使用账号登录AU直播App,进入到主页进行直播或观看其他用户的直播。

2. 开启直播:用户登录后,可以点击App上的直播按钮,开启自己的直播。在开启直播之前,用户可以设置直播标题、直播标签、直播封面等相关信息,以吸引更多的观众。

3. 观看直播:其他用户可以在AU直播App上浏览直播列表,选择自己感兴趣的直播进行观看。观众可以在直播中实时发送弹幕,与主播进行互动。

4. 礼物与打赏:观众可以为喜欢的主播发送礼物或打赏,以表达对主播的支持和喜爱。主播收到礼物或打赏后,可以进行感谢和回应。

5. 弹幕互动:在直播过程中,观众可以发送弹幕评论、点赞、提问等互动内容,与主播和其他观众进行实时交流和互动。

6. 关注与分享:观众可以关注自己喜欢的主播,以便第一时间收到主播的直播通知。观众还可以将喜欢的直播分享到社交平台上,让更多的人了解和观看。

总结:AU直播App是一款实时视频直播应用,通过视频编码与传输、服务器处理、视频分发、视频解码与播放等环节,实现了用户的实时交流和互动。用户可以通过注册登录、开启直播、观看直播、送礼打赏、弹幕互动、关注分享等功能来享受直播的乐趣。


相关知识:
app商城开发一般要多少钱
开发一个APP商城涉及到很多方面,包括设计、开发、测试等环节,因此价格会有很大的不同。下面是一些常见的费用项目:1. 设计费用:设计费用主要包括APP的界面设计和用户体验设计。这部分费用取决于设计师的水平和项目的复杂程度。一般来说,设计费用占总费用的10%
2023-07-14
app开发一站式互动组件
App开发一站式互动组件是指在移动应用开发中,提供一个集成了多种互动功能的组件,方便开发者快速构建具有互动性的应用。这些互动功能包括但不限于用户注册登录、社交分享、评论留言、点赞收藏、实时通讯等。一站式互动组件的原理是通过集成第三方服务或使用自研的互动功能
2023-06-29
app开发高级
App开发是当今互联网领域最受欢迎的技术方向之一。它涵盖了从Web开发到移动应用开发等广泛的应用程序开发。在这篇文章中,我们将介绍有关App开发的一些原理以及详细的介绍。首先,App开发需要学习许多技术,其中包括计算机编程语言、软件工程和设计,并需要具备良
2023-06-29
app开发定制的价格
APP开发定制是一个非常让人感兴趣的话题,因为随着智能手机的广泛普及,APP已经成为人们日常生活中必要的工具。在这篇文章中,我们将探讨APP开发定制的价格以及其背后的原理。一、APP开发定制的价格因素1. 功能需求:APP开发的定制价格与所需功能数量和类型
2023-06-29
app开发公司如何挑选
在当今互联网时代,移动应用开发已经成为了一个非常热门的领域,而在市场竞争日益激烈的情况下,选择一个合适的app开发公司便显得尤为重要。那么,如何挑选一家好的app开发公司呢?接下来,本文将从以下七个方面为你详细介绍。一、专业技能专业技能对于选择一家优秀的a
2023-06-29
app定制开发优缺点
随着智能手机的普及,移动应用程序已经成为人们生活中不可或缺的一部分。到目前为止,有数百万的应用程序可供下载,以满足用户的各种需求。然而,对于一些企业或组织来说,定制化的应用程序可能更适合他们的需求。在本文中,我将详细介绍应用程序定制开发的优缺点。什么是应用
2023-05-06